Geekbench 5 Benchmarks
Intel Core i7-8700T | vs | Intel Core i5-14400 |
---|---|---|
Apr 2nd, 2018 | Release Date | Jan 8th, 2024 |
Core i7 | Collection | Core i5 |
Coffee Lake | Codename | Raptor Lake |
Intel Socket 1151 | Socket | Intel Socket 1700 |
Desktop | Segment | Desktop |
6 | Cores | 10 |
12 | Threads | 16 |
2.4 GHz | Base Clock Speed | 2.5 GHz |
4.0 GHz | Turbo Clock Speed | 4.7 GHz |
35 W | TDP | Not Available |
14 nm | Process Size | 10 nm |
24.0x | Multiplier | 25.0x |
UHD Graphics 630 | Integrated Graphics | UHD Graphics 730 |
No | Overclockable | No |
